Markel parts ways with top executive as it merges business lines

Markel International, a subsidiary of Markel Corporation, is to merge its marine and energy business lines under the leadership of Rohan Davies, in a move that will see the departure of its longtime marine leader.

Davies (Pictured) will lead a combined wholesale marine and energy division as part of its strategic growth plans, with Chris Fenn, the current divisional managing director of marine, leaving the business to pursue other opportunities.

Operating as two separate business lines since 2018, the decision to combine the businesses under Davies, the current divisional managing director of energy, is designed to further enhance the broker and client proposition and support the continued delivery of its long-term growth strategy, Markel said in a statement.

The wholesale operation, headed by Andrew McMellin, remains on track to achieve its goal of being a US$2bn (GWP) player by 2025, as part of Markel’s global insurance operation’s previously disclosed goal to reach $10 billion in GWP within five years (end of 2025), yielding $1 billion of underwriting profits.

McMellin said: “The decision to merge the two divisions will move us along in our ambitious growth trajectory and will enable us to better leverage the synergies across our energy and marine offer including energy property and liability products, renewables and project cargo.

“The enhanced offer will benefit our broking partners, deepen our client relationships and align our distribution strategies. Furthermore, the increased scale and balance will help us navigate the volatility that is being experienced within the broader market for these classes.”

On the leadership changes, he added: “This is a well-deserved promotion for Rohan, who I’m certain will approach this important role with the direction, drive and innovative thinking that he is already renowned for at Markel and across the market.

“Chris has been a highly valued part of Markel since he joined in 2008 and leaves with our best wishes. I know I join the entire business in thanking him for his significant contribution over the years.”
